The Oxfiniti Process is a new concept in wastewater treatment. As well as treating municipal wastewater (ASP), it is applicable to industrial wastewater treatments, river restoration, storm water treatment and other applications where oxidation of wastewater is required. Established in the US over 10 years ago, the patented process was introduced into the UK in 2014 and has since been adapted and utilised successfully at four UK Water Utilities. The small footprint of the process and innovative side-stream treatment of the wastewater enables the process to be utilised as a:
1) Mobile Emergency Breakdown Treatment unit
2) Supplementary Oxygen Supply during Planned Maintenance Events
3) Supplementary Oxygen Supply for Overloaded works
4) Capital Works Upgrades
5) Treatment Process Targeting High Ammonia Wastes
The performance and flexibility of operation has been demonstrated by four UK Water Utilities and has shown:
1) Energy savings of 20%+ and hence Carbon Emission Reduction
2) The Oxygen extracted at a safe low pressure on site from Air
3) A Quick and Easy set up within a Portable Containerised unit
4) Very Simple Operation and Maintenance Schedule
5) Significant Health & Safety Benefits in Set up and Operation
6) Advanced Satellite Remote Monitoring

Features
-
Delivers higher oxygen transfer rates compared to traditional air systems;
-
Portable system with small footprint enabling fast and easy installation.
-
Set up on a new site in less than 12 hours depending upon logistics;
-
Innovative mixing device enables alpha figures (α) throughout the ditch to be >0.9;
-
Mechanical and physical process. Requires no additional chemicals in treatment process;
-
No periodic major maintenance in the basin (e.g.for diffusers or acid washing diffuser);

Benefits
-
No dangerous and costly stored liquid oxygen or use of high pressure systems;
-
All equipment is self contained within the box and sits along the side of the basin, H&S risks are greatly reduced;
-
No disturbance to existing infrastructure;
-
Low maintenance costs – is carried out easily within the box unlike traditional aeration systems.
-
More robust and reliable system than existing aeration systems;
-
No degradation in performance over extended periods of time unlike fine bubble diffusers that require routine acid washing to maintain competitive oxygen transfer rates.
